The aim of this study was to investigate the effect of tartrate ion (C4H4O62-) on the extraction and separation of zinc and cadmium using D2EHPA extractant. The presence of tartrate ion in the solution caused the shift of  the  extraction curve of zinc and cadmium to the more alkaline pH; however, the shifting rate for the cadmium extraction curve was more significant.
